A historically black neighbourhood in Pittsburgh, PA, USA located around Forbes Avenue about 15 city blocks from the point. In its heyday it was a centre of jazz, blues, theatre and culture for much of the city. The construction of freeways and highways in the 50s caused it to become cut off from the rest of the city (many houses were torn down as well) this lead to a rise in crime, poverty and general deterioration of the neighbourhood during the 60s, 70s and 80s recently there have been some moves to revitalise this area though none have been successful. To most Pittsburghers it’s still known as a “bad neighbourhood.”
